About Mesa Laboratories
Mesa Laboratories, Inc (NASDAQ: MLAB) is a global provider of instrumentation products designed for critical process monitoring, testing and calibration. Headquartered in Lakewood, Colorado, the company serves a diverse set of end markets including healthcare, pharmaceutical, food and beverage, energy and industrial sectors. With a focus on precision measurement and validation, Mesa Laboratories helps customers ensure regulatory compliance, product safety and operational efficiency across complex manufacturing and sterilization processes.
The company’s product portfolio encompasses biological and chemical indicators for sterilization process validation, digital data loggers and sensors for environmental monitoring, and optical gas analyzers with sample-conditioning solutions for oil, gas and petrochemical applications.
